Reasons to book a car rental in and around Katoomba

Renting a car in Katoomba offers you the freedom and flexibility to explore this beautiful region at your own pace. With a rental vehicle, you can easily manage your luggage and plan your itinerary without the constraints of public transportation. This is especially advantageous for families and outdoor enthusiasts looking to experience the stunning natural scenery. Key attractions like Katoomba Scenic World, the iconic Three Sisters, and Echo Point Lookout are all located within Katoomba, allowing for convenient day trips. Additionally, you can venture slightly further to destinations such as Leura, just 2 km away, where you can enjoy Sublime Point Lookout and Leura Cascades. Blackheath, located 9 km from Katoomba, is another great spot featuring Campbell Rhododendron Gardens. The nearby Blue Mountains, only 8 km away, provide even more opportunities for adventure and exploration. With a rental car, you can effortlessly visit these sites, ensuring a comfortable and enjoyable experience for all types of travellers.

Where to stay around Katoomba

  • Katoomba: As the gateway to the Blue Mountains, Katoomba offers a variety of accommodations with easy access to iconic attractions such as Katoomba Scenic World and the breathtaking Three Sisters. This area is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ts, adventure seekers, and those looking to soak in stunning scenery. Visitors can explore local restaurants and cafes, making it a convenient base for your stay.
  • Leura: Located only 2 km from Katoomba, Leura is renowned for its charming village atmosphere and proximity to natural wonders. It features attractions like Sublime Point Lookout and Leura Cascades, making it ideal for families and couples seeking an outdoor adventure. The area is dotted with delightful eateries and wineries, enhancing your stay with local flavours.
  • Blackheath: Situated 9 km from Katoomba, Blackheath is a suburb that provides a serene retreat with stunning views and outdoor activities. Key highlights include the Campbell Rhododendron Gardens and access to national parks. This area is perfect for those who appreciate nature and adventure, with nearby wineries offering an opportunity to indulge in local wines.
  • Blue Mountains: Just 8 km from Katoomba, the Blue Mountains are a must-visit for outdoor lovers and adventure seekers. With attractions such as Echo Point Lookout and cable car rides, this region provides an unforgettable experience amidst breathtaking landscapes. Accommodations in this area offer a unique opportunity to immerse yourself in nature while enjoying nearby dining options.

10 tips to save on your car rental in and around Katoomba

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by selecting vehicle type and desired features. Whether you require an SUV for additional space, a convertible for summer enjoyment, or an economy car for budget-friendly options, leverage the filters on Expedia to identify the best fit for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ental rates can vary based on demand, so it's advisable to secure your vehicle well ahead of your trip. Booking early often allows you to lock in lower prices and ensures better availability, particularly during peak travel se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Generally, smaller cars come at a lower rental price and are easier to park in crowded areas. Mid-size options provide a nice balance between affordability,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under the age of 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ily surcharges, and certain vehicle categories—like SUVs or luxury models—might be restricted. This can also apply to renters over the age of 70. Always verify the age requirements prior to making a reservation.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rentals operate under a full-to-full fuel policy, which means you must return the car with a full tank to avoid additional fees. This is typically the most advantageous option. Others might provide full-to-empty or prepaid fueling alternatives, which are also acceptable. Just ensure you return the car empty in this scenario.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at the airport often incurs a surcharge, but this added convenience may be worth the expense.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ies exclusively acc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and provides peace of mind should something unforeseen occur during your travels. It's straightforward to add car rental insurance while booking with Expedia.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If your plans include long road trips, seek out rentals that offer unlimited mileage to prevent additional char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is necessary to rent a car.

Where can I find a Katoomba car rental if I am younger than 25?
Some Katoomba outlets will rent cars to drivers under 25 years of age, and others won't. Policies differ from supplier to supplier, so you'll want to do some research. Also, find out if there are extra costs. Some places will pass on a surcharge to young drivers between the ages of 21 and 24. Always read through the terms and conditions to avoid any surprise fees.
